Output 41392049f0919c0cf50a70d40885614b7952a53eeafc6db612b215e6a2e707d4:0

value
491552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d588e2cac87ee96769f793b8957dfd1414f17583 OP_EQUAL
address
3MA5qQLXG5AwcBcyJTzCokYzo3LZsh4uTb
transaction
41392049f0919c0cf50a70d40885614b7952a53eeafc6db612b215e6a2e707d4
spent
true